Produktbeschreibung
What influences does the Caribbean environment have to play on the specificities of its architecture? Are the current models of architecture proposed in the French West Indies adapted to the context in which they are set? What are the habits and customs of the way of life and the way of building in the humid tropical zone? What bioclimatic strategies would allow a better global well-being' and what would be the influence of man on this type of construction? What architecture is envisaged for the West Indies in 2050?
